Your role in helping us shape the future:
The Associate Editor position is part of Advice Products, a team that works on product content such as profile pages, landing pages and methodology pages. The role focuses on content for the Health and Education verticals, and will also work intermittently on content for Careers, Real Estate, Law or other verticals. The primary responsibilities of this role are fact-checking, line editing and copy editing. Other duties include working in a content management system and updating content using SEO best practices.
This position works closely with many stakeholders, including product managers, technology specialists, SEO professionals and other editors.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ented and has a keen eye for proofreading and storytelling.
